Tips To Crack The PSLE Papers

The Primary School Leaving Examination (PSLE) season is approaching and kids, as well as parents, are beginning to worry. Kids are staying up late night and parents are returning early to help their kids study better. Although relying on just last minute studying is not the way to crack PSLE, these quick tips will help you score better.
Solve Past Year’s PSLE Papers:
Solving the previous year’s PSLE papers for PSLE Science, PSLE Math and PSLE English can help students understand the paper pattern and the type of questions that are asked. It is essential to have a clear understanding of what kind of questions appear in PSLE. Practising past year PSLE papers shall make the student not only confident, but will also help them finish the paper faster due to practice. Students must pay special attention to the average distribution of topics in PSLE Science, PSLE Math and PSLE English respectively. Knowing the average distribution, can help students plan their study schedule accordingly and pay more attention to the high-scoring topics while revising.
Find Your Own Revision Pattern:
Not all students can wake up early and revise and on the other hand, not all students can cope up with late night studies. Based on the child’s habit and what they are comfortable with, they can set their own revision pattern. Each person’s brain ability is different and therefore, do not follow what others are doing. What might work for other students might not work for you. PSLE papers can be stressful and therefore, it is important to have a comfortable revision pattern.
Make Time For Play
Let your child take time off and play. Even though it may sound counter productive, it is not. Breaking away from routine activities such as playing or even watching television, only deter your child from concentrating. In fact if you give them short play breaks, when they do actually sit to study, their focus shall be much better, making them avoid silly mistakes when solving PSLE papers and even remembering and retaining things better.
Take Notes:
A Scientific American Research reveals that students who study from handwritten notes remember better and for a longer duration than those who don’t. Therefore, while studying and revising, don’t forget to keep your notepad handy. Make a note of PSLE Math formulas, this way you will easily be able to recollect the formula while taking the PLSE Math Paper. You visually remember your handwriting better than the printed copy.
Time Management:

Have realistic revision timetables and do not put yourself into any kind of pressure, for it might negatively impact your retaining capabilities. Right time management can help the student stay focused, making revision less dull and dreary.
Lastly, don’t let the PSLE papers pressurise you and impact your health. For if it does, all your studying efforts could go in vain. Take proper rest, sleep well, and eat right. Our last bit of advice - don’t just chase the grade, enjoy the learning process, as there’s a lot that you can gain and enjoy.
